Colors

Choose light and airy colors

When it comes to summer home decor, choosing the right colors can make a big difference in creating a bright and refreshing atmosphere. Opt for light and airy colors like whites, creams, pastels, and light grays. These colors not only reflect the sunlight, making your space feel brighter, but also create a sense of openness and tranquility. They also serve as a great backdrop for other decorative elements, allowing them to stand out and add pops of color.

Incorporate pops of bright colors

While light and airy colors are perfect for creating a summer ambiance, incorporating pops of bright colors can add excitement and energy to your space. Consider using vibrant hues like yellows, oranges, blues, and greens in your decor. You can do this by adding colorful throw pillows, cushions, or even a brightly colored accent wall. These pops of color will instantly liven up your space and give it a playful summer vibe.

Consider pastel shades

Pastel shades are another great option to consider when decorating your home for the summer. Soft pinks, baby blues, mint greens, and lavender tones can create a dreamy and serene atmosphere. Pastel colors are soothing to the eye and give off a cool and refreshing feeling. Incorporate pastel shades in your furniture, curtains, bedding, or even in the artwork on your walls for a subtle and elegant summer look.

Use earthy tones

If you prefer a more natural and organic feel for your summer decor, consider using earthy tones. Colors like warm browns, soft tans, and deep greens can evoke a sense of nature and bring the outdoors inside. You can incorporate earthy tones through your furniture, rugs, curtains, or even through decorative elements like vases or artwork. These colors will create a cozy and inviting atmosphere that blends seamlessly with the summer season.

Fabrics

Opt for lightweight and breathable fabrics

When choosing fabrics for your summer home decor, it’s important to opt for materials that are lightweight and breathable. Fabrics like cotton, linen, and silk are ideal choices as they allow air to circulate and keep you cool during the hot summer months. Use these fabrics for curtains, bedding, upholstery, and even for decorative accents like table runners or pillow covers. Not only will they make your space feel more comfortable, but they will also give it a light and airy look.

Use natural textiles

In addition to lightweight fabrics, incorporating natural textiles can further enhance the summer vibe in your home. Materials like jute, seagrass, rattan, and bamboo bring a touch of nature indoors and create a relaxed and tropical feel. You can use these natural textiles for rugs, lampshades, baskets, or even as wall coverings. They add texture and visual interest to your space while keeping it in tune with the summer season.

Try sheer curtains and linens

To let in as much natural light as possible and create a breezy look, consider using sheer curtains and linens. Sheer fabrics like voile or chiffon allow sunlight to filter through while still providing privacy. Hang them in your windows or use them as room dividers to add a soft and ethereal touch to your summer decor. Sheer linens can also be used in table settings or as drapery for canopies or beds, creating a romantic and dreamy atmosphere.

Furniture

Go for outdoor furniture

When it comes to summer home decor, incorporating outdoor furniture indoors is a great way to create a laid-back and relaxed atmosphere. Outdoor furniture is typically designed to withstand the elements and is made from materials like wicker, rattan, or teak. These materials not only add a touch of natural beauty to your space but are also lightweight and easy to move around. Consider using outdoor lounge chairs, dining sets, or even an outdoor sofa in your living room or patio area for a stylish summer look.

Use wicker or rattan pieces

Wicker and rattan furniture is synonymous with summer decor. These materials bring a tropical and coastal feel to any space and instantly create a relaxed and inviting ambiance. Use wicker or rattan chairs, stools, coffee tables, or even storage baskets to add texture and warmth to your home. These versatile pieces can be paired with cushions in bright colors or patterns to add a touch of personal style and create a cozy seating area.

Consider hammocks and swings

For the ultimate summer relaxation, consider incorporating hammocks or swings into your home decor. These playful and whimsical pieces are perfect for creating a vacation-like atmosphere in your outdoor or indoor spaces. Hang a hammock on your patio or balcony and enjoy a lazy afternoon nap, or install a swing indoors to create a cozy reading nook. These additions not only provide a unique and fun element to your decor but also create a sense of relaxation and tranquility.

Accessories

Add tropical or nautical elements

To truly embrace the summer season, adding tropical or nautical elements to your home decor can transport you to a beachside paradise. Look for decor pieces inspired by the ocean, such as seashells, starfish, anchors, or coral. Incorporate them into your artwork, throw pillows, or even as centerpiece decorations. Alternatively, opt for tropical-inspired decor like palm leaves, pineapples, or flamingos to create a vibrant and lively atmosphere. These accessories will instantly brighten up your space and add a touch of summer fun.

Use fresh flowers and plants

Bringing the outdoors inside is a wonderful way to create a summer-like ambiance. Fresh flowers and plants not only add natural beauty but also purify the air and create a sense of tranquility. Consider placing vases of colorful flowers on your tabletops, windowsills, or entryway. You can also incorporate potted plants or hanging planters to bring life and freshness to your space. Whether you choose tropical plants like palms or colorful blooms like hibiscus, these natural elements will add a touch of summer magic to your home.

Include colorful throw pillows and cushions

One of the easiest and most cost-effective ways to spruce up your summer home decor is by incorporating colorful throw pillows and cushions. Choose vibrant patterns, tropical prints, or bold solid colors to add a pop of brightness to your furniture. You can mix and match different patterns and textures to create a visually interesting and playful look. These small accessories can instantly transform the atmosphere of your space and make it feel more inviting and summer-ready.

Lighting

Utilize natural sunlight

Incorporating natural sunlight into your summer home decor is a must. Make the most of your windows by keeping them clean and free from heavy curtains or blinds. Opt for light and sheer window treatments that allow sunlight to filter through while still providing privacy. Arrange your furniture in a way that maximizes the natural light and creates a bright and airy atmosphere. Natural sunlight not only illuminates your space but also boosts your mood and energy levels, making your summer home feel vibrant and welcoming.

Hang string lights or paper lanterns

To add a touch of whimsy and create a cozy ambiance, hang string lights or paper lanterns in your outdoor or indoor spaces. These soft and warm lights create a magical and enchanting atmosphere, perfect for summer evenings or outdoor gatherings. Hang string lights across your patio or balcony, drape them along the walls or ceilings, or wrap them around trees or bushes to create a festive look. Similarly, paper lanterns in various colors or shapes can be hung or suspended to add a unique and charming element to your decor.

Use light and sheer window treatments

In addition to utilizing natural sunlight, using light and sheer window treatments can further enhance the summer vibe in your home. Sheer curtains or blinds allow light to pass through while reducing glare and providing privacy. Consider using light-colored or white sheers that not only create a bright and airy look but also give your space a soft and romantic feel. These window treatments can be paired with heavier curtains for added insulation or used alone to create a breezy and summery atmosphere.

Textures

Incorporate natural textures like jute or seagrass

To add depth and visual interest to your summer home decor, incorporating natural textures like jute or seagrass is a great option. These materials bring a touch of warmth and earthiness to your space and create a sense of connection with the natural world. You can use jute or seagrass rugs, baskets, or even wall hangings to add texture and visual contrast. These natural textures work well with light and airy colors and can be combined with other materials like wood or rattan for a cohesive and summery look.

Add textured wall art or tapestries

To make a statement and add a unique element to your summer home decor, consider incorporating textured wall art or tapestries. Textured pieces like woven wall hangings, macrame art, or even 3D geometric designs can add depth and dimension to your walls. These decorative elements not only create a focal point in your space but also evoke a bohemian and laid-back vibe. Whether you choose a large statement piece or a collection of smaller textured artworks, they will instantly elevate the style and ambiance of your home.

Use embroidered or woven fabrics

Another way to incorporate textures into your summer home decor is by using embroidered or woven fabrics. Opt for throw blankets, pillows, or table runners with detailed embroidery or intricate weaving. These textiles add a touch of luxury and craftsmanship, enhancing the overall look and feel of your space. They can be used to layer with other fabrics or can stand alone as decorative accents. Embroidered or woven fabrics provide a cozy and tactile experience, inviting you to relax and enjoy the summer season.

Themes

Choose beach or coastal themes

A popular theme for summer home decor is the beach or coastal theme. Embrace the serene and breezy ambiance of the ocean by incorporating elements like seashells, coral, or driftwood. Use coastal-inspired colors such as blues, whites, and sandy neutrals to create a calming and refreshing atmosphere. Decorate your space with nautical accents like anchors, ropes, or ship wheels to enhance the beachy vibe. Whether you live near the coast or not, a beach or coastal theme can transport you to a seaside retreat.

Embrace a tropical or jungle theme

For those who want to embrace the vibrant and exotic feel of the summer season, a tropical or jungle theme is a great choice. Use bold and lively colors like greens, yellows, oranges, and pinks reminiscent of lush tropical landscapes. Incorporate tropical plants like palm trees, banana plants, or Monstera leaves to bring a sense of nature indoors. Add elements like animal prints, bamboo accents, or tropical-inspired artwork to further enhance the theme. A tropical or jungle theme will infuse your space with energy and create a tropical paradise in your home.

Opt for a relaxed and bohemian style

If you prefer a more laid-back and eclectic summer home decor, opting for a relaxed and bohemian style is ideal. Embrace mix and match patterns, colorful textiles, and handmade pieces to create a boho-inspired look. Use rattan or wicker furniture, layered rugs, and floor cushions for a casual and comfortable seating area. Incorporate global-inspired accents like Moroccan lanterns, Indian tapestries, or African mudcloth pillows to add a unique and worldly charm. A relaxed and bohemian style invites you to kick back and enjoy the carefree spirit of summer.

Indoor-Outdoor Flow

Create seamless transitions between indoor and outdoor spaces

To fully embrace the summer season and make the most of your home, create seamless transitions between your indoor and outdoor spaces. Open up your living area by installing large windows or glass doors that lead to your patio or garden. This allows for natural light to flood into your home and brings the outdoors in. Consider using sliding glass doors, French doors, or even bi-fold doors to create a fluid connection between your indoor and outdoor areas. By blurring the boundaries, you can enjoy the best of both worlds and create a sense of openness and freedom.

Use large windows or glass doors

One of the key elements in achieving a seamless indoor-outdoor flow is by maximizing the use of large windows or glass doors. These features not only fill your space with abundant natural light but also provide beautiful views of the surrounding landscape. Install floor-to-ceiling windows or opt for sliding glass doors that open up to your outdoor areas. By allowing your indoor and outdoor spaces to visually connect, you create a sense of continuity and make your home feel more spacious and inviting.

Set up outdoor seating areas

To fully enjoy the summer season, it’s important to set up outdoor seating areas that are just as inviting and comfortable as your indoor spaces. Whether you have a spacious backyard, a cozy balcony, or a small patio area, create seating arrangements that encourage relaxation and socializing. Consider using comfortable outdoor lounge chairs, hammocks, or even a swing for a touch of playfulness. Add outdoor cushions, throw blankets, and side tables for convenience and style. By creating a welcoming outdoor retreat, you extend your living area and make the most of the summer weather.

Design with Nature

Bring in elements from nature like shells, driftwood, or coral

Incorporating elements from nature is a wonderful way to enhance your summer home decor. Look for items like seashells, driftwood, or coral to create a beach-inspired atmosphere. Arrange these natural treasures in glass jars, on shelves, or as centerpieces to bring a touch of the seaside indoors. You can also use natural materials like stones, pebbles, or pinecones to add an organic and earthy feel to your decor. Designing with nature allows you to connect with the outdoors and infuse your space with the beauty of the natural world.

Use natural materials like bamboo or sisal

To create a summer-inspired look that is eco-friendly and sustainable, incorporate natural materials like bamboo or sisal into your home decor. Bamboo can be used for flooring, furniture, or even as decorative elements like room dividers or window blinds. Sisal rugs or mats add texture and warmth to your space while being environmentally friendly. These natural materials not only bring a sense of serenity and tranquility but also contribute to creating a healthy and green home environment.

Incorporate indoor plants and greenery

One of the best ways to bring a touch of nature into your summer home decor is by incorporating indoor plants and greenery. Choose plants that thrive in bright and sunny conditions, such as succulents, ferns, or tropical palms. Place potted plants in your living room, dining area, or even in your bathroom to create a refreshing and vibrant atmosphere. Hanging plants or vertical gardens can be used to maximize space and add visual interest to your walls. Indoor plants not only improve air quality but also bring life and vitality to your home decor.

Keep it Minimal

Avoid clutter and excessive decorations

To create a clean and refreshing summer home decor, it’s important to avoid Clutter and excessive decorations. Keep your space open and uncluttered by decluttering and organizing your belongings. Get rid of items that no longer serve a purpose or bring you joy. Opt for a minimalist approach by choosing only the essentials and keeping surfaces clear of unnecessary items. Less is more when it comes to a summer-inspired look, allowing your space to feel calm, spacious, and welcoming.

Opt for a clean and uncluttered look

A key aspect of minimalism is maintaining a clean and uncluttered look throughout your home. This means keeping surfaces clear, organizing your belongings, and avoiding excessive ornamentation. Opt for simple and streamlined furniture pieces with clean lines and minimalistic designs. Use hidden storage solutions to keep your belongings out of sight and maintain a clutter-free environment. By embracing a clean and uncluttered look, you create a sense of tranquility and allow your space to breathe during the summer months.

Choose simple and functional furniture

When selecting furniture for your summer home decor, prioritize simplicity and functionality. Choose pieces that serve a purpose and meet your specific needs. Avoid ornate or overly decorative designs that can clutter your space. Opt for furniture with clean lines, neutral colors, and versatile styles. Consider multifunctional pieces like storage ottomans or extendable dining tables to maximize your space. By focusing on simplicity and functionality, you create a harmonious and comfortable environment that is perfect for summer living.
